The Gunners were already top of the standings but knew that a positive result at Tottenham Hotspur Stadium could be hugely valuable to pad their lead after Manchester City lost to Manchester United the day before.
They were gifted the lead inside a quarter of an hour thanks to a dreadful error from Hugo Lloris before Martin Odegaard doubled the advantage as the visitors took total control.
Spurs showed at least some fight after the break and it took some excellent goalkeeping from Aaron Ramsdale to keep out Ryan Sessegnon and Harry Kane.
Any hope of a comeback seemed to die at least 15 minutes before fulltime, though, as the Gunners eased to their first away league win over Spurs since 2014 to seize control of the title race as the season approaches the halfway point.
